KyAnn Waters’ Initiation Into Submission: High Protocol #6 – Perfectly Played blends dark romance, power dynamics, and criminal intrigue into a story that moves with the intensity of a forbidden connection. The novel focuses on Tinker, a submissive who has long embraced the pain‑and‑fear edge of her BDSM world, yet craves something deeper and more permanent. Her desire to be owned becomes the emotional core of the book, and Waters uses that longing to explore vulnerability, loyalty, and the cost of surrender.
Luca Bruno enters the story with the kind of presence that immediately shifts the balance of power. He’s a man shaped by the shadows of his mafia lineage, trying to maintain a veneer of legitimacy while still entangled in dangerous family secrets. His attraction to Tinker is immediate but complicated, and Waters leans into that tension—Luca wants more than a fleeting encounter, yet claiming her risks igniting conflicts he can’t fully control. Their chemistry is written with a slow, deliberate burn, grounded in trust, dominance, and the emotional stakes of choosing someone who could upend your entire world.
The novel thrives on the interplay between the structured world of High Protocol and the unpredictable danger of the Bruno crime family. Tinker’s loyalty to the dungeon and Luca’s ties to his family create a push‑and‑pull that keeps the story taut. Waters doesn’t shy away from the darker edges of both BDSM and mafia romance, but she keeps the focus on the characters’ emotional journeys rather than shock value. Tinker’s evolution—from a submissive seeking sensation to a woman confronting the risks of being truly claimed—is particularly compelling.
While the romance reaches a satisfying emotional conclusion, Waters intentionally leaves several threads about the Bruno family unresolved. Instead of feeling incomplete, these lingering mysteries set the stage for the upcoming dark‑mafia series, promising deeper dives into the criminal world that shapes Luca’s life. Readers who enjoy interconnected series will likely appreciate how this book acts as both a standalone love story and a bridge to something larger.
Overall, Perfectly Played delivers a blend of sensual tension, emotional depth, and looming danger. It’s a story about surrender—not just in the BDSM sense, but in the willingness to trust someone enough to let them into the most guarded parts of your life. Waters crafts a romance that feels both intimate and expansive, leaving readers eager to follow the Bruno family into whatever darkness comes next.
Tinker is a constant and enigmatic presence through the earlier books in the High Protocol series. She is always at the club. She is a heavy masochist and plays with most Doms. But she has a hard limit of no vaginal penetration with either cocks or fingers. She is a virgin.
The owner and staff of the club fiercely protect her, but she guards her life and her secrets (and even her name).
This is her story.
The author has explored different subgenres in the BDSM Club romance genre in her books in this series. This book hits the "dark mafia romance" subgenre. And hits it quite well.
The Dom who takes her heart is very Italian, very connected, very conflicted. The book turns into quite a page-turner and the action is quite gripping and sometimes quite violent. Also, serious kudos to the author for describing the seriousness of even peripheral gunshot wounds -- many romance authors who put some action/adventure elements in the story go with an amazingly fast, easy, and complete medical recovery.
